Evaluation of depth of anaesthesia with midlatency auditory evoked potentials and stress in elderly patients
AIM:To compare the changes of midlatency auditory evoked potentials,hemodynamic and plasma eortisol concentrations in elderly patients during general anaesthesia,in order to evaluate the value of MLAEP and stress in elderly patients of depth of anaesthesia.METHODS:F0ny patients scheduled for selective upper abdominal surgery with general anesthesia were randomly divided into 2 groups,one group was the young(aged 20-55 years old),the other was the old(ages 60-81 years old),each with 20 cases.They were all ASA Ⅰ-Ⅱ,cardiac function Ⅰ-Ⅱ,and no endocrine disorders and hearing impairment.Intubating and ventilating to control breathing machine after induction,HR,MAP,the wave amplitude and latency of MLAEP were recorded when patients entered the operating room(TO),3 min after induction of anesthesia(T1),1 min after intubation (T2),2 min after skin incision(T3),after abdominal Commissioner(T4),and after extubation(T5).Meanwhile,3 ml blood samples were abtained from the right internal jugular vein at all time points,and measured plasma's CORT concentrations.RESULTS:After administration,two groups of patients'incubation period of Pa,Nb were extension,and the volatility of Pa/Na,Pa/Nb were reduced(P<0.05);at TO,the Pa was longer in the old than in the young(P<0.05).HR was statistical significant differences in 2 groups after administration when compared with previous adminstration(expect T2);at T5,HR was faster in the young than in the old(P<0.05).Map at T1,T2,T3,T4 were slowly compared with previous administration(P<0.05),and at T4,MAP was higher in the young than in the old(P<0.05).CORT changed every time compared with previous administration (P<0.05),but the 2 groups was no statistical significant dirrerences(P>0.05).CONCLUSION:MLAEP combined with hemodynamics and plasma cortisol can effectively evaluate the depth of anesthesia in the elderly.
